Automotive Jobs in Kentucky with H-1B Sponsorship
Kentucky's automotive sector is one of the most active in the country, anchored by Toyota's Georgetown assembly plant, Ford's Louisville operations, and a dense network of Tier 1 and Tier 2 suppliers across the state. Engineering, manufacturing, and technical roles at these employers regularly require H-1B sponsorship, with hiring concentrated in Louisville, Georgetown, and Elizabethtown.

Which automotive companies sponsor H-1B visas in Kentucky?
Toyota Motor Manufacturing Kentucky in Georgetown is one of the largest H-1B sponsors in the state's automotive sector, followed by Ford's truck and SUV plants in Louisville. Major Tier 1 suppliers including Magna, Denso, and Toyoda Gosei also have Kentucky facilities with documented H-1B filing histories. Sponsorship decisions are made at the individual employer level and vary by role, team, and hiring cycle.
Which cities in Kentucky have the most automotive H-1B sponsorship jobs?
Louisville and Georgetown account for the highest concentration of automotive H-1B roles in Kentucky. Georgetown is home to Toyota's flagship North American assembly plant, while Louisville hosts Ford's Kentucky Truck Plant and Louisville Assembly Plant. Elizabethtown and Bowling Green also have notable supplier and manufacturing presences, with Bowling Green tied to Corvette production at the GM plant.
What types of automotive roles typically qualify for H-1B sponsorship in Kentucky?
Roles that qualify for H-1B sponsorship must meet the specialty occupation standard, meaning they require at least a bachelor's degree in a specific field. In Kentucky's automotive sector, this typically covers mechanical, electrical, and manufacturing engineers, quality assurance specialists, supply chain analysts, embedded systems developers, and robotics or automation engineers. General production or assembly line roles do not meet the specialty occupation threshold and are not H-1B eligible.

Are there any Kentucky-specific considerations for H-1B sponsorship in automotive?
Kentucky does not impose state-level visa or work authorization requirements beyond federal H-1B rules, but the state's automotive hiring is highly cyclical and tied to vehicle production schedules. H-1B petitions in this sector are often tied to specific project needs, so roles may open and close quickly. Kentucky also has a significant supplier ecosystem, and smaller Tier 2 or Tier 3 suppliers may have limited prior H-1B sponsorship experience, which can affect processing timelines.
What is the prevailing wage for H-1B automotive jobs in Kentucky?
U.S. employers sponsoring a visa must pay at least the prevailing wage, which is what workers in the same role, area, and experience level typically earn. The Department of Labor sets this rate to make sure companies aren't hiring foreign workers simply because they'd accept lower pay than a U.S. worker. It varies by job title, location, and experience. You can look up current prevailing wage rates for any occupation and location using the OFLC Wage Search page.
